Output 2ae6409306cc56507120ff1dd08d2a19b0b1af4e8ff976e554a000e0451f9eab:5

value
26832512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e905b9a3b4e991c58fd027122f0eeafd60167f9 OP_EQUAL
address
MDby4UrKt8Dmjn3QCxviDaQtmQjWdkoo5d
transaction
2ae6409306cc56507120ff1dd08d2a19b0b1af4e8ff976e554a000e0451f9eab
spent
true